制作英语音频软件可以通过以下步骤进行:
选择开发平台和语言
选择适合开发该软件的平台和语言,如React Native或Flutter,支持iOS和Android系统。
语言可以选择Java、Objective-C、Swift等。
实现录音功能
利用平台提供的音频录制API,如Android中的MediaRecorder类,iOS中的AVAudioRecorder类,进行音频的录制、暂停、停止等操作。
实现配音功能
通过音频编辑库或语音合成API,如Android中的FFmpeg、iOS中的AVFoundation,将文本转换为音频。
使用平台提供的音频播放API,如Android中的MediaPlayer类,iOS中的AVAudioPlayer类,进行音频的加载、播放、暂停、停止等操作。
实现用户界面和交互设计
使用UI设计工具如Sketch、Adobe XD等设计用户界面。
使用开源框架如React进行开发。
选择合适的音频编辑软件
可以选择现有的音频编辑软件如《音频大师》、《音频裁剪大师》、《音频编辑转换器》等,这些软件提供了音频剪辑、合并、转换等功能,便于制作英语听力音频。
利用AI配音助手
使用AI配音助手如熊猫宝库,将文字转成不同语言的音频,添加背景音乐等。
制作英语听力材料
可以利用在线工具如“一起作业”制作英语听力材料,编辑并保存为音频文件。
生成二维码
使用麦拓二维码生成器小程序,将音频文件上传并生成二维码,通过扫码收听音频。
通过以上步骤,你可以制作出一个功能齐全的英语音频软件,满足制作英语听力材料的需求。建议根据具体需求和开发经验选择合适的工具和平台,以确保软件的质量和用户体验。